This new era brought forth a host of films that prioritized authentic chemistry. masterfully wove together multiple love stories of three cousins, each dealing with heartbreak and new beginnings in a bustling city. Annayum Rasoolum (2013) offered a gritty, realistic portrayal of a taxi driver and a salesgirl, whose relationship navigates real-world obstacles like religious differences. This wave proved that contemporary audiences were hungry for stories about ordinary people in everyday situations, moving away from larger-than-life heroes to relatable characters who stumble, make mistakes, and find love in the most unexpected ways.

The landscape of Malayalam cinema, often referred to within digital spaces and regional contexts through mobile-centric culture as Kerala movies, has underwent a massive transformation in how it depicts human relationships. From the melodramatic, socio-political family dramas of the 20th century to the hyper-real, nuanced, and psychologically complex narratives of the modern era, Kerala’s filmmakers have consistently redefined romance.
